Willow Tree Removal in Doylestown, PA

Willow tree removal services involve the careful and safe elimination of mature willow trees from residential or commercial properties. This process is often requested when trees become diseased, pose safety risks, interfere with construction projects, or simply need to be cleared for landscape redesign.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the removal, including whether the entire tree, roots, and stump will be taken out, and the potential impact on surrounding landscaping or structures. Proper removal can help prevent property damage and ensure safety, especially for large, sprawling trees like willows that have extensive root systems.

Before requesting willow tree removal, property owners should consider factors such as the size and health of the tree, proximity to buildings or power lines, and any local regulations or permits that might be required. It’s also helpful to understand the methods used for removal, including how the stump will be handled afterward, whether grinding or complete extraction is preferred.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the project meets expectations and is completed efficiently and safely.

FAQ

Willow Tree Removal Questions

What are common reasons to remove a willow tree? Removal may be considered due to disease, damage, safety concerns, or to make space for new landscaping projects.

How is a willow tree typically removed? The process involves cutting the tree down and removing the stump, often using specialized equipment to ensure safety and efficiency.

Is stump removal necessary after tree removal? Yes, removing the stump helps prevent regrowth, eliminates tripping hazards, and allows for future landscaping or construction.

What should property owners consider before removing a willow tree? Consider the tree's size, location, and condition, as well as any potential impact on nearby structures or utilities.
